      <image:caption>Ka whāngaia, ka tipu, ka puāwai Nurture, grow, blossom This whakataukī captures the essence of Mobilising for Action that sought to nurture people to grow and blossom to protect taonga species across Aotearoa / New Zealand.  When people are mobilised to protect taonga species, these will be nurtured, and continue to grow and blossom. Mobilising for Action focused on the human dimensions of ngahere/forest health and more specifically where the ngahere is affected by, or threatened by kauri dieback and myrtle rust. Mobilising for Action developed and supported research that explored the connections between people and the ngahere, people and te taiao (the environment) and people and taonga species such as kauri and pohutukawa.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>Mobilising for Action was one of seven research themes within the Ngā Rākau Taketake ­– Saving our Iconic Trees programme developed and funded by the Biological Heritage National Science Challenge.  These research themes focused on accelerating kauri dieback and myrtle rust research and management and contributed specifically to research to understand, support, engage and empower New Zealanders in their efforts to save the ngahere from current and future biological threats.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>Mobilising for Action drew on the analogy of a waka hourua double-hulled canoe navigating through an ocean.   Each hull of the canoe represents a body of knowledge that informed the research. One hull represents Indigenous knowledges, as epitomised by mātauranga Māori, and the other hull represents Western science perspectives. The ocean we navigate is te taiao – our environment. The waka hourua was a fitting conceptual framework to underpin the research undertaken by Mobilising for Action.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>Three critical research goals guided Mobilising for Action’s research framework for the three years of the programme: 2020-21:  Whakamārama – To Understand What meaning do people attach to te taiao, ngahere, and taonga species? 2021-22: Whakapiri - To Engage How can people’s connection to te taiao, ngahere, and taonga species be fostered and supported now and in the future? 2022-2023 Whakamana - To Empower How can people be empowered to make a difference now and in the future, to ensure te taiao, ngahere, and taonga species flourish? While these research goals were identified as discrete annual goals, each is mutually constitutive and cannot be disentangled from the others. Therefore: whakamārama drives whakapiri and whakamana whakapiri drives whakamārama and whakamana, whakamana drives whakamārama and whakapiri.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>Mobilising for Action’s research framework and strategy was developed from the findings of a scoping investigation which saw the co-leads engage with over 170 people from both Crown Research Institutes and universities; iwi, hapū and whānau; kaitiaki and rangatira; local, regional and central government agencies; industry and community groups, and non-governmental organisations.</image:caption>

Marie is a social scientist with research interests in: science and society interactions particularly relating to environmental issues and community &amp; stakeholder engagement in biosecurity, pest management and agricultural sustainability. Marie's research projects have also investigated principles that facilitate greater alignment and more effective communication between scientists and community practitioners to facilitate community science interactions, including citizen science projects, and dialogue around contested environmental issues. Marie has worked in biosecurity research since 2009 across a diverse range of roles including: Biosecurity Science Advisory Group Kauri Dieback Technical Advisory Group Accelerating Kauri Protection Independent Panel Kauri Dieback Strategic Science Advisory Group Knowledge Advisory Group (kauri dieback/myrtle rust)</image:caption>
